Miniature and Toy Dog Breeds – Your Ultimate Guide
More and more people are starting to prefer adopting miniature and toy dog breeds. Why? Mostly because they are both cheaper and easier to maintain. For one, they do not require the same amount of food needed by a bigger breed. Plus, you do not have buy shampoo as often as you would if you have a Labrador Retriever or a St. Bernard. However, the “economical” factor is but one of the reasons why people in general are starting to want smaller pets. Their small bodies only take little space. This makes them suitable for people who live in condominiums and high – rise apartment buildings.
So if you have had your eyes on smaller dogs as a pet but you can't seem to decide, here are some of the more famous miniature and toy dog breeds that you may want to consider.
The Chihuahua
Origin and History: Chihuahuas originated from Mexico and were regarded as a sacred dog by the Aztecs. It is said that they had the capability to cleanse sins and guide their master's spirit to the Underworld. As such, when their masters die, they were usually killed and buried with their owners so that they can continue serving even during the after – life.
Appearance: The Chihuahua is considered to be the smallest breed of dog as recognized by the American Kennel Club. Their height can reach anywhere in between 6 to 15 inches and should only weigh below 6 lbs. They can either have a short or long coat depending on their blood line and country of origin.
Temperament: Despite their “cute” appearance, Chihuahuas can be nasty. Their over protectiveness causes them to attack if they feel that their family and their territory is threatened. Generally, the long haired varieties can be gentler compared to the short coated ones.
The Shih Tzu
Origin and History: These furry dogs were said to originate in Tibet or China. Their name literally translates to “Lion Dog”. Their DNA analysis also confirms that they belong to one of the oldest breeds recognized so far.
Appearance: They are easily distinguished because of their long double coats and large round eyes. Their coat can be so long that it is necessary to brush them to avoid tangles. Their ideal height should be anywhere below 10 ½ inches and should not weigh above 16 pounds.
Temperament: Accompanying Chinese royalty has gained them that air of arrogance that they carry. They can be independent and can attack only when provoked. However, they can be a sweet and trusting house pet when given enough love.
The Pug
Origin and History: Contrary to what others may think, this breed originated from China. Just like the Shih Tzus they are sometimes regarded as the Lion Dog due to its resemblance to the Chinese Guardian Lion.
Appearance: They have a short stubby face with strong muscular legs. Their coat color can either be fawn, apricot, silver or black.
Temperament: They are known to be very sociable, charming and clever. They may be stubborn sometimes but they are relatively easy to train.
